Relating to or connecting the abdomen and a cyst, bladder, or hollow organ within the abdominal cavity.
From Latin 'abdomen' plus Greek 'kystis' (bladder or pouch), combining anatomical terminology to describe conditions or connections involving both structures.
This term appears mostly in obscure medical texts describing rare conditions—it's medical jargon that's so specific that only the handful of specialists dealing with those particular complications ever need to say it.
